Puerto San Miguel nestles beneath cliffs in an almost landlocked bay in the north of Ibiza. The hotel is terraced into the pineclad hillside, with superb views of San Miguel Bay.

The hotel was clean, but a little worn around the edges. I think it is definately time for a refurbishment. The food was ok, nothing startling and not much variety. This is my personal opinion and others in our party thought the food was great.

The Hotel San Miguel is set in a breathtakingly beautiful cove. It is in a very quiet location, with just a couple of bars and supermakets close by. However, if you are all inclusive as our party were this isn't really a problem.

The beach is literally just below the hotel and we spent everyday there, as it was much more relaxing than staying around the pools, which were rather full of children (as you would expect from a super family hotel. The beach was perfect as you could hire canoes free of charge if you were all inclusive. The banana bot was good and you could also hire pedeloes or learn to windsurf. There was also a daily boat that took you to Portinax and a glass botton boat.

The staff were helpful and pleasant. Beware of the slippery nipples - a pernod and baileys concoction that the staff in the Western Sallon bar insisted you drink at regular intervals!!

The entertainment was excellent. As mentioned in previous reviews Zorro and his team worked exceedingly hard and without fail got everyone up on their feet each night dancing to follow my leader.

This hotel, I feel would be a nightmare if you did not have children with you. I would not return if it was just my partner and myself holidaying alone, but I would definatley return with our friends and their children.



The children in our party joined the kids club and thought the Thomson kids reps were good.

Hotel:
We stayed in the Sam Miguel Hotel (formerly the Cartago)and so can't comment on the Beach Club.
Yes, the hotel is looking a little tired in places and a refurb is warranted. Having said that, we found the rooms comfortable and clean with great views over the beach and bay.There seemed to be an army of cleaning staff for the hotel and all were polite and smiling. Pool and pool area were clean and tidied daily - no thanks to the charmer who left their deposit in the pool on two different days!(Although the pool was closed and disinfected very quickly).Special mention of the bar staff in the Western Saloon should be made as they all worked very hard to minimise the queues for drinks (beware the pernod/baileys concoction!). Many thanks also to the restuarant Manager, Alfredo, for organising a reserved table and bottle of fizz for our wedding anniversary (we had asked Thomsons to do this on booking but nothing transpired, we also asked for adjoining rooms at the same time but this too didn't happen). Only things to mention on the downside were one room phone u/s, the pool edging gets very slippery,the corner of the pool by the ramp up to the bar level was very whiffy, and the lifts operate on a totally different system to what you're used to!
Food:
The hotel seems to operate on a 7 day cycle, but there's enough choice not to eat the same dish on the same day two weeks running. Restaurant staff were very quick to clear plates and tables and clean up.
We were very disappointed with both the quality and quantity available in the Chinese restaurant. General cleanliness of the restaurant was very good.
Entertainment:
Much has been said of Zorro, Ollie, Chris and Natasha including some not so complimentary comments. Some parents wouldn't keep youngsters off the stage despite numerous repeated pleas from the team, no wonder the team get hacked off (though you'd be hard pushed to notice it). These four certainly earn their money, but don't expect UK style political correctness! To get upwards of 400 people up singing and dancing is no mean achievement. Boogie Nights was definately the highlight! The only Thomson entertainer worthy of note was Claire for her sheer enthusiasm. On the whole the entertainment was thoroughly enjoyable.
General: this complex could be improved by the installation of an ATM machine.
